Assuming they don't just mix up the gameplay completely and that the next game will still mostly resemble the survivor games. I'd like:

- Pacing, story and characters on par with 2013.
- Relics and documents in the style of 2013
- Variety of locations of rise
- If rpg elements have to be there (shops, sidequests etc) then similar to rise
- core gameplay of shadow (outside of paititi I mean)
- tombs of the quantity and difficulty of shadow

All three games have different pros and cons, if they just took the pros from all three you could potentially make a fantastic survivor style game.

Then as far as things completely new. We could have vehicles back, would be neat to have the motorbike back and have large vehicle based hubs. Could have large ocean hubs like underworld.

Would also be cool to delve further into the supernatural. Could have some kind of supernatural equipment. Like having telekinesis could make for some interesting puzzles.

And then as far as setting, desert and urban are the only two obvious ones I can think of that the survivor games haven't done in a big way yet.
